What is COLLTS?

Cultivating Oral Language and Literacy Talents in Students (COLLTS) is a research-based early childhood instructional resource from The Center for English Learners at the American Institutes for Research (AIR).

A major goal of the Center for English Learners at AIR is to create the highest quality early childhood resource to meet the needs of English Learners and Dual Language Learners that all children can benefit from.

The Center for English Learners at the American Institutes for Research, along with Lee & Low Books, works closely with districts and universities to provide customized support that prepares instructional staff to meet the demands of high academic standards for dual language learners.

Meet our newest trainers for COLLTS

Shannon Keuter is a senior researcher at AIR. Ms. Keuter has more than 15 years of experience and content knowledge in education research and technical assistance related to young children and DLLs. Ms. Keuter holds master’s degrees in linguistics and education, as well as a certificate in Spanish-English translation. She is fluent in Spanish.

Diana Torres is a technical assistant consultant at AIR. Ms. Torres has 12 years of experience as a dual-language classroom teacher, district instructional facilitator, and EL compliance auditor. She currently supports various projects that assist states in defining program models to support DLLs and ELs, early childhood transition for families, and language and literacy professional learning opportunities for teachers of dual language learners. Ms. Torres holds a BS with a focus in bilingual education and an MEd in educational leadership and policy studies. She is a native Spanish speaker and proud parent of a young bilingual elementary student.
